However, I do recommend using Crish Stick Nevada with caution in situations that require dense information or long copy. While it excels in headlines and callouts, it may not be the best choice for detailed content or formal communication. Always pair it with a clean sans serif font for body text to ensure a balanced typographic hierarchy.
Crish Stick Nevada for Font Pairing and Design Assets
Font pairing is an essential part of any design project, and Crish Stick Nevada offers several options for collaboration. I’ve successfully paired it with modern sans serif fonts like Montserrat or Lato for a clean contrast, and with script fonts for a more elegant feel. It also works well with handwritten fonts in certain contexts, though I’d suggest testing it in different combinations to find the best match for your brand.
Before using Crish Stick Nevada in client campaigns or digital products, I always check the included styles, ligatures, weights, and file formats. Ensuring multilingual support and commercial font licensing is also important, especially if you plan to use it in ads, merchandise, or branded content.
